【Product Promotion】 i-CORE AiPGTL Series Level Translators – Full-Scenario Coverage for High-Speed Bidirectional Level-Shifting Needs
【Introduction】
I-CORE has launched the AiPGTL series of high-speed bidirectional level-shifting chips, with a product line covering 2-channel and 4-channel GTL-to-LVTTL bidirectional transceivers as well as 2-channel, 8-channel, and 10-channel bidirectional low-voltage translators. Leveraging four core advantages – high speed, low power consumption, strong anti-interference, and high reliability – this series is well-suited for high-speed signal interconnection in advanced digital systems. It precisely fills the gap in domestic GTL level-shifting chips, providing a stable and reliable localized solution for various high-speed signal transmission applications.

【Key Features】
1. LVTTL-to-GTL Level Transceivers (Ideal for High-Speed Bus Designs)
Core Features:
l Accepts 5 V TTL inputs at a supply voltage of 3 V to 3.6 V
l GTL side supports 3.6 V input/output
l Compatible with GTL-/GTL/GTL+
l GTL reference voltage can be set to any value from 0.5 V to VCC/2
l I/O pin protection: ±8000 V HBM protection
Representative Models: AiPGTL2012, AiPGTL2014

2. Bidirectional Low-Voltage Translators (Ideal for Universal Voltage Interconnection in All Scenarios)
Core Features:
l Supports signals from 0.8 V to 5 V, directly usable with GTL, GTL+, LVTTL, TTL, or 5 V CMOS level signals
l Automatic direction sensing – no direction control required
l Low on-resistance
l Low power consumption
l No latch-up risk
Representative Models: AiPGTL2002, AiPGTL2003, AiPGTL2010

【Application Fields】
Servers/data centers: buses, motherboards
Networking: switches, routers, firewalls, baseband, transmission
Industrial: PLCs, instruments, power control
Embedded/multimedia: AV equipment, multi-core boards
Level translation: multi-voltage bridging, memory expansion
